ABOUT THE PROGRAM

 

The management of health services occurs in an environment of rapid organizational and technological change. Individuals charged with executive and managerial responsibilities must be grounded in a formal and solid professional training followed by lifelong learning which fosters their continuous professional growth. Students interested in healthcare management careers should explore the Bachelor and Master of Health Services Administration degrees.


Students interested in exploring the healthcare field or supplementing their educational experience with a minor or certificate in healthcare management and policy should explore information on the Minor (for undergraduates) and the certificate (for graduate students) in the academic programs links.


Students interested in a career in Public Health with a specialization in health policy and management will find a description of the Master in Public Health (MPH) as well as the specialization in HPM in the academic programs link.
